Overview

Mechanical Maintenance Technician - Aerospace and Defence

Permanent, long term opportunity in the Milton Keynes area. The successful Mechanical Maintenance Technician will join the Engineering Services Team, reporting to the Team Leader. The role involves conducting planned and reactive maintenance to the facility, including installation and modification of the facility.

Typical working hours: Full time, 40 hours per week, shift work (typical hours are 06:30 and 14:00 on a rotating basis).

Responsibilities
  • Conduct inspections, maintenance and repairs of the equipment involved with the facility.
  • Testing and mechanical services (planned maintenance).
  • Repair of plant and equipment during breakdowns.
  • Fault-finding in accordance with supervisory instructions (reactive maintenance).
  • Installation of new plant and equipment in accordance with supervisory instructions.
  • Share ideas on design and implementation improvements, as appropriate.
  • Compliance with Health, Safety and Environmental procedures.
  • Provide input for the preparation and adherence to risk assessments and method statements.
  • Compliance with site security procedures.
  • Member of Emergency Response team.
Skills, Qualifications and Knowledge
  • Mechanical Apprenticeship and/or significant demonstrated experience.
  • Experience with installing, maintaining, repairing, and inspecting industrial plant equipment and systems, such as:
    • High Pressure compressed air systems.
    • Water cooling & treatment systems.
    • Plant lubrication and hydraulic systems.
    • Mechanical machinery and infrastructure, including rotating/reciprocating components (gears, chains, linkages, and actuating rods).
  • Team player, capable of coaching and mentoring less experienced employees.
  • Flexible and positive attitude, willing to go that extra mile to meet deadlines/schedules.
  • Attention to detail in terms of quality of work.
  • Drive and commitment to improve skills and be receptive to new ideas/ways of working.
  • Self-motivated with good communication and a can-do attitude to overcome issues that arise.
